Transaction 2884683b553af9a68c1cd4eb7e574e7b98455a694326cc5746b3aade4f9cdae8

20 Input
2 Outputs
  • 2884683b553af9a68c1cd4eb7e574e7b98455a694326cc5746b3aade4f9cdae8:0
  • value  112253922
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 2884683b553af9a68c1cd4eb7e574e7b98455a694326cc5746b3aade4f9cdae8:1
  • value  591065
    address  3GeLtmx2UgjknArg6a8GdRF1u3hyYz6tcg